Leadership Review Briefing — Warranty-Cost Overrun

Warranty costs on the Ferrow HX pump line exceeded provision by 14% this quarter, driven by seal failures in units shipped from the Dunmarle plant between March and June. Corrective tooling is in place, and the supplier, Kalvane Components, has accepted partial liability pending inspection results. Finance should hold an additional reserve against Q4 claims and model two recovery scenarios for the review. The confidential note below summarises the business plans shaped by this overrun.

confidential, kagup-bafog: Fraaxax Group is in early talks to buy Soroxox Group for about $343.8 million. The Olidor launch date is June 14, and nothing goes to the press before then. Legal wants the Aldmirek Logistics term sheet signed before July 23.

# Break-Glass: Corvid UI Library

Corvid components follow strict semver; breaking changes require an RFC. Break-glass publishing is only for severity-1 rollbacks when the release pipeline is down. Use the emergency publisher account, bump only the patch version, and file an incident within one hour. The publisher keystore is sealed; unseal it with the recovery passphrase below.

unlock words, fafop-hawep: briwyn-oliix-sorox

Handover — studio duty, Fenwick Media Room. Camera kit charged, spare mics in cabinet two. Bookings run back-to-back Tuesday; buffer 15 minutes between each. Lighting rig flickers — ticket already raised with facilities. Keep the door closed during recordings; corridor noise carries. Water the plant, ignore the thermostat. Door lock was recoded Monday; the new entry code is below.

staff pass of kawip-hawef = bdg-QLP-2

# Break-Glass: Catalog Cache Invalidation

Scope: the Pinrow product catalog at Veldstone Retail. If stale prices persist after a purge and the Hollowmere invalidation queue is wedged, use break-glass to flush the edge tier directly. Contractors: get verbal sign-off from the catalog lead first. Steps: open the Hollowmere admin shell, select emergency-flush, confirm the tenant, and run it once — repeated flushes thrash the origin. Access is logged and expires after 20 minutes. Unseal the admin shell with the passphrase below.

recovery phrase for kahop-tajog: istix-casvan